Woman killed when car crashes into ditch and tree, South Carolina officials say

One person was killed and another was injured Sunday when a car crashed into a ditch and tree, according to the South Carolina Highway Patrol.

The single-vehicle collision happened at about 2:35 a.m. in Laurens County, said Lance Cpl. Nick Pye.

A 2012 Nissan coupe was driving south on Georgia Road, and near the intersection with Hellams Road the car ran off the right side of the road, according to Pye. The car hit a ditch then crashed into a tree, Pye said.

The Laurens County Coroner’s Office said 22-year-old Gray Court resident Keundrea Thompson died at the scene, WHNS reported.

The coroner’s office said Thompson was driving the Nissan at a high rate of speed when she ran a stop sign and veered off the road, according to WYFF.

A passenger in the Nissan was injured and taken to an area hospital, Pye said. Further information on the passenger’s condition was not available.

There was no word if either Thompson or the passenger were wearing seat belts.

The crash continues to be investigated by the Highway Patrol and coroner’s office.

Through Sunday, 823 people had died on South Carolina roads in 2023, according to the state Department of Public Safety. Last year, 1,091 people died in crashes in South Carolina, DPS reported.

At least 25 people have died in Laurens County crashes in 2023, according to DPS data. Last year, 24 deaths were reported in the county, DPS reported.
